Why finance ERP licensing is a strategic risk decision in regulated environments
In regulated industries, finance ERP licensing is not a back-office procurement detail. It directly affects auditability, segregation of duties, data residency, reporting access, integration rights, and the long-term economics of modernization. For banks, insurers, healthcare networks, utilities, public sector entities, and life sciences organizations, the wrong licensing model can create hidden cost exposure and governance friction long after implementation is complete.
Most enterprise buyers initially compare license price per user or annual subscription value. That is too narrow. A credible finance ERP licensing comparison must evaluate architecture alignment, cloud operating model constraints, compliance obligations, extensibility rights, non-production environment costs, analytics entitlements, and the operational resilience implications of vendor-controlled release cycles.
The core issue is not simply whether a platform is cheaper. The issue is whether the licensing structure supports a regulated operating model without forcing expensive workarounds in controls, integrations, reporting, or regional deployment governance.
The four licensing models most often evaluated
| Licensing model | Typical ERP pattern | Primary advantage | Primary risk in regulated enterprises |
|---|---|---|---|
| Named user subscription | Cloud SaaS finance ERP | Predictable recurring pricing | Cost inflation for broad workflow participation and audit access |
| Role-based or tiered user licensing | Midmarket and enterprise cloud ERP | Better alignment to user complexity | Ambiguity around occasional users, approvers, and shared services |
| Module or capacity-based subscription | Platform-centric SaaS suites | Simplifies user growth economics | Can obscure integration, storage, API, or environment charges |
| Perpetual plus maintenance | Legacy or hybrid ERP estates | Control over upgrade timing and asset treatment | Higher infrastructure burden and slower modernization |
In practice, regulated enterprises often operate across more than one model at the same time. A global manufacturer may retain perpetual licenses for core financials in one region, adopt SaaS planning in another, and add subscription-based compliance tooling on top. The licensing comparison therefore needs to assess coexistence costs, not just greenfield pricing.
How ERP architecture changes the licensing conversation
Licensing cannot be separated from ERP architecture comparison. Multi-tenant SaaS platforms typically bundle infrastructure, upgrades, and baseline security operations into subscription pricing, but they also centralize release management and may limit deep database-level customization. Single-tenant cloud or hosted models can offer stronger isolation and more deployment control, yet often introduce additional environment, storage, and managed service costs.
For regulated finance functions, architecture affects what the license really buys. If a SaaS ERP includes standard controls, workflow, and reporting but requires premium add-ons for advanced audit trails, regional data retention, or external compliance reporting, the apparent subscription advantage can narrow quickly. Conversely, a perpetual or hosted model may appear flexible until the enterprise prices patching, disaster recovery, encryption key management, and validation overhead.
This is why enterprise decision intelligence should compare licensing and architecture together: user metrics, environment rights, API entitlements, extension frameworks, and release governance all shape the true operating model.
Key licensing evaluation dimensions for regulated finance organizations
- User metric design: named, concurrent, employee-based, role-based, approver, external auditor, and shared service access rights
- Environment entitlements: development, test, training, sandbox, validation, and disaster recovery instances
- Compliance scope: audit logging, retention controls, e-signature support, segregation of duties, and regional data residency
- Integration economics: API limits, middleware requirements, event access, batch interfaces, and third-party connector charges
- Analytics rights: embedded dashboards, data export, warehouse access, and premium reporting modules
- Extensibility boundaries: low-code rights, custom objects, workflow automation, and upgrade-safe customization options
These dimensions matter because regulated enterprises rarely deploy finance ERP as a standalone ledger. They connect it to procurement, treasury, payroll, tax engines, GRC platforms, identity systems, data lakes, and industry-specific applications. A license that looks efficient for core accounting users may become expensive once approvers, auditors, controllers, compliance teams, and integration services are included.
SaaS subscription versus perpetual licensing in regulated finance
| Evaluation area | SaaS subscription ERP | Perpetual or legacy-hosted ERP | Strategic implication |
|---|---|---|---|
| Cash flow profile | Opex-oriented recurring spend | Higher upfront capex plus maintenance | Finance leadership must align accounting treatment with modernization goals |
| Upgrade governance | Vendor-driven release cadence | Customer-controlled timing | Regulated validation processes may favor control, but delayed upgrades increase risk |
| Infrastructure responsibility | Mostly vendor managed | Mostly customer or partner managed | SaaS reduces technical burden but not compliance accountability |
| Customization model | Configuration and extension frameworks | Broader code-level flexibility | Deep customization can preserve legacy complexity and raise lifecycle cost |
| Scalability economics | Fast geographic and user expansion | Expansion may require more infrastructure planning | SaaS often scales faster, but user-based pricing can rise sharply |
| Exit complexity | Potential vendor lock-in through data and process dependence | Legacy lock-in through custom code and infrastructure | Both models create lock-in, but through different mechanisms |
SaaS finance ERP is often the preferred modernization path because it standardizes operations, shortens infrastructure lead times, and improves access to continuous innovation. However, regulated enterprises should not assume SaaS automatically lowers risk. If release schedules, data location options, or workflow constraints do not align with internal control frameworks, the organization may shift cost from infrastructure to governance and remediation.
Perpetual licensing remains relevant where validation cycles are strict, local hosting requirements are non-negotiable, or highly customized finance processes cannot yet be standardized. But the tradeoff is clear: more control over timing usually means more responsibility for resilience, patching, interoperability, and technical debt management.
Where hidden finance ERP licensing costs usually emerge
The most common procurement mistake is comparing base subscription or maintenance rates without modeling adjacent cost drivers. In regulated environments, hidden costs often appear in non-production environments, premium support tiers, audit and compliance modules, API overages, storage growth, document management, e-invoicing networks, and regional localization packs.
Another frequent issue is underestimating the cost of broad participation. Finance ERP workflows increasingly involve procurement approvers, legal reviewers, project managers, plant controllers, and external auditors. If the licensing model charges full rates for light-touch users, the enterprise may either overspend or restrict access in ways that weaken operational visibility and control effectiveness.
A disciplined ERP TCO comparison should therefore include software, implementation, integration, validation, security operations, change management, reporting, environment management, and exit planning. In regulated sectors, compliance evidence generation and control testing should also be treated as recurring operating costs.
Realistic enterprise evaluation scenarios
Consider a multinational healthcare provider evaluating a cloud finance ERP with named user pricing. The base commercial proposal appears competitive for 1,200 finance users. The economics change when the organization adds 4,000 occasional approvers, external audit access, two extra validation environments, regional data retention requirements, and integrations to revenue cycle, payroll, and procurement systems. The winning platform is not the one with the lowest user fee, but the one with the most sustainable operating model under compliance load.
A second scenario involves a regulated utility running a heavily customized on-premises finance ERP under perpetual licensing. Maintenance costs seem stable, but the enterprise faces rising infrastructure refresh expense, limited interoperability with modern analytics, and slow close-cycle improvement. Here, a SaaS migration may increase annual software spend while still producing better operational ROI through faster reporting, lower technical support burden, and improved control standardization.
Vendor lock-in analysis and interoperability considerations
Vendor lock-in in finance ERP licensing is not only contractual. It is architectural and operational. Multi-tenant SaaS lock-in often appears through proprietary workflow models, embedded analytics, low-code extensions, and data extraction limitations. Legacy lock-in appears through custom code, bespoke integrations, and institutional dependence on specialized administrators.
For regulated enterprises, interoperability should be evaluated as a licensing issue because API rights, event access, connector pricing, and data export terms directly affect the cost of maintaining a connected enterprise systems strategy. If treasury, tax, GRC, and enterprise data platforms require premium integration entitlements, the ERP may become a bottleneck rather than a control hub.
| Decision factor | Questions procurement should ask | Why it matters in regulated environments |
|---|---|---|
| Audit and compliance access | Are auditors, reviewers, and read-only users charged separately? | Unexpected access fees can undermine control transparency |
| Data portability | What export formats, retention windows, and extraction tools are included? | Exit readiness and regulatory response depend on accessible data |
| Integration rights | Are APIs, connectors, and event streams included or metered? | Connected controls and reporting require predictable interoperability |
| Release governance | How much notice, testing time, and deferral flexibility is available? | Validation-heavy organizations need structured change control |
| Regional deployment options | Can data residency and localization requirements be contractually supported? | Cross-border compliance can invalidate a low-cost licensing model |
Executive decision framework for finance ERP licensing selection
- Start with operating model requirements, not vendor price sheets: define regulatory obligations, control design, reporting cadence, and regional deployment constraints first
- Model three-year and seven-year TCO separately: short-term implementation economics and long-term platform lifecycle economics often point to different conclusions
- Segment users by behavior: core finance, occasional approvers, auditors, shared services, and external parties should not be priced as one population
- Test interoperability early: validate API, identity, data export, and analytics rights before commercial negotiation closes
- Negotiate governance terms, not just discounts: release notice periods, sandbox rights, support SLAs, and data portability clauses materially affect risk
For CIOs, the central question is whether the licensing model supports a secure, scalable, and governable architecture. For CFOs, the question is whether recurring spend produces measurable improvements in close efficiency, compliance posture, and reporting quality. For procurement leaders, the objective is to convert ambiguous commercial language into enforceable operational rights.
Recommended platform fit by enterprise profile
Highly standardized, multi-entity organizations with strong cloud readiness often benefit from SaaS finance ERP licensing when user segmentation is well negotiated and integration rights are clear. These enterprises typically value faster deployment, standardized controls, and lower infrastructure burden more than deep customization freedom.
Organizations with strict validation cycles, sovereign hosting requirements, or highly specialized finance processes may still justify hybrid or customer-controlled deployment models. In those cases, the licensing strategy should include a modernization roadmap so the enterprise does not preserve expensive complexity indefinitely.
The strongest enterprise scalability outcomes usually come from platforms that balance standardization with governed extensibility. In regulated environments, that means selecting a licensing model that supports workflow participation at scale, predictable integration economics, and resilient reporting access without forcing the organization into excessive custom development.
